Unsung - Season 11

Season 11
Episodes

Wyclef Jean
Wyclef Jean skyrockets to fame with his group, The Fugees, in the late '90s; hits like "We're Trying to Stay Alive'' and "Gone Till November.''

Jagged Edge
The melodic harmonies of Jagged Edge dominate the early 2000s with back-to-back No. 1 hits and two double-platinum albums.

Marvin Sapp
Marvin Sapp spreads the Gospel through song for over three decades; dominating the gospel charts in the 2000s with seven Top 10 hits.

Switch
Switch, the multi-talented, multi-instrumental Midwestern powerhouse band bursts onto the black music scene as newcomers to the legendary Motown roster in the mid-'70s.

The Dramatics
Through the '70s, The Dramatics take the five-man vocal group to another level by seamlessly mixing powerful and piercing lead vocals with silky harmonies.

Shanice
Shanice exploded on the worldwide stage in the early 90's with the four simple words "I Love Your Smile.''

Ice-T
With a no nonsense style and larger than life persona, Ice-T has lived nine lives: pimp, bank robber, DJ, army officer, con man and even award winning actor and producer.
